Tree replacement in Kaneohe is imposed through ROH Chapter 40 Article 8 for Exceptional Trees, ROH Β§10-1.4 for street trees, and LUO landscaping rules for commercial and subdivision development.
Honolulu has no single tree-replacement ordinance, so obligations attach to specific permit paths. Exceptional Tree alteration permits under ROH Β§40-8 often condition approval on in-kind replacement or protective mitigation. Street tree removal under Β§10-1.4 generally requires the property owner to replant an approved species at their own expense. New commercial projects, parking lots, and subdivisions in Kaneohe must also meet Land Use Ordinance landscape and shade-coverage standards in ROH Title 21. Failing to replant as required can lead to citations and city back-charges.
Civil fines, permit revocation, and city-assessed replacement costs apply for non-compliance.
